Hakkenden: Eight Dogs Of The East - Season One (2013/Section 23/Sentai Blu-ray)


Picture: B Sound: B Extras: C Episodes: B+



Five years after their village was destroyed, there were only 3 survivors: Shino, Sosuke and a girl name Hamaji. Bound by love and hate, they are fated to find the 8 legendary Bead Holders, that they are the reincarnated Dog Warriors of the past that once helped Princess Fuse defeat the forces of evil. As they travel they find other warriors like them with supernatural powers, beads they secretly protect humanity from the forces of evil in Hakkenden: Eight Dogs Of The East - Season One (2013).


Shino and Sosuke are one of the Hakkenden, a warrior reborn from the past. They hide their abilities from the people because anyone with powers are considered 'demons'. They are secretly charged by the church to find others like them with their own secret purposes. Shino is an 18 year-old boy trapped in 13 year-old body, his lifeforce is bound with Murasame, a living sword within his body that often takes on the form of a crow. Sosuke can transform into a dog, and considers himself Shino's guardian/pet. They are join later after saving Genpachi and Kobungo, two soldiers who were in the army. They must not only find the other reincarnated warrior spirits but protect the humans from various supernatural forces that church turns a blind eye towards.


Based on the novel and manga of the Hakkenden, this series paints a world ancient Japan with western influences with supernatural powers. Tales of love and lost, that the Japanese believe all demons or oni were born from humans with tragic pasts. However in this series the main characters are considered demons for their supernatural power, who are trying to protect human society even they know if they will never be accepted.


The 1080p 1.78 X 1 digital High Definition image and lossless DTS-HD MA (Master Audio) 2.0 Stereo mix are clear, warm and rich, as usual with Sentai releases. Extras include commentaries, clean open and closing animations and trailers.

Borders - Long ago there were 3 survivors of a epidemic that wipe out a village. Now they are wards of the Church with a secret past that they share.


Humans & Demons - Shino and Sosuke meet Kobungo who is trying to rescue Genpachi from monks who believe he is an evil demon.


The Approaching Demon - Shino is given the mission of finding the other bead holders, but decides to help Kobungo rescue Genpachi from the monks after he turn into his demon form.


Homecoming - Kobungo tells Shino of him and Genpachi's past and how they became 'demons'.


Divine Blessing - Shino meets a girl from the Snake God Clan.


Stashed - Shino enters a water deprived village and learns of the curse mountain with a Monkey God.


A Promise - After gold is discover on the cursed mountain, it is flooded with greedy gold prospectors which angers the Monkey God, who made a promise to a certain young girl.


Encounter - Shino and Sosuke meet Dosetsu who life was saved by Yukihime an old friend/snow fairy, who in turn saved Dosetsu life at the cost of her voice.


Guard - Hamaji attends an all girls school and learns her roommate isn't exactly human.


A Lonely Figure - Shino meets the beautiful Kohaku who is cursed with her own tragic past.


True Self - After Shino escapes death he reverts to his true age and form.


Compensation - Kohaku time is running out and she makes a deal with the devil, but can Shino save her soul?


Karma - The church notices Shino's recent adventures and investigates his powers ...and Murasame.
